Angry What have I done!?!

Hi Folks,

The other day I moved my car from Ohio to Michigan on a trailer. As the battery was dead and I didn't have any jumpers handy, I put the battery from my truck in the XKE... back

I touched the leads briefly before I realized what I was doing. I heard a little electrical pop sound from the front of the engine. The car did start right up, but the fuel pump didn't work. It ran long enough to get it off the trailer. As the fuel pump is not fused, I have no idea what to look for here... much less the rest of the electricals. Thankfully there are no computers on board!

Any thoughts on what damage I might have done and what I might need to do to get the fuel pump working again?

disconnect fuel pump and hook a temporary wire from battery to it if it runs you know the relay for the pump is blown, replace it with a new one! (the subsitute ones from advance Auto are $10. and better than the originals but don't look like the Lucas.
